1.
概述:成本敏感型企业的目标与约束
- 目标是以有限预算获得稳定、低延迟的用户体验。
- 约束通常为带宽费用、实例规格和运维人力成本。
- 关键衡量指标:响应时延(RTT)、P95响应时间、带宽使用和月度总成本。
- 针对面向中国大陆用户,可优先选择带 CN2 链路的 Singapore 节点以降低抖动与丢包。
- 本文包含配置示例、测速数据、表格对比与真实客户案例,便于落地实施。
2.
网络优化技巧(面向 CN2 路径)
- 选择带 CN2 的出口节点,优先提高对中国的路由质量与稳定性。
- 使用 TCP 优化(启用 BBR 拥塞控制)可在高丢包环境下提高吞吐。
- 调整 MTU 与开启 keepalive 减少握手开销,适当配置短连接复用。
- 在服务器端启用 HTTP/2 或 gRPC,多路复用减少并发连接数。
- 做定期路由跟踪(traceroute)与丢包监控,识别中间链路瓶颈并申请运营商改路。
3.
实例规格与成本对比(示例)
- 成本敏感时按需选择低规格实例并辅以缓存与 CDN,减少上游带宽。
- 下表为典型两档配置与测得的网络延迟/吞吐示例(基于实际测试,地域为中国东部):
| 方案 |
vCPU / 内存 / 存储 |
带宽/月 |
平均 RTT(ms) |
估算月费(USD) |
| 轻量型(示例A) |
1 vCPU / 1GB / 40GB SSD |
1 TB |
~70 ms |
约 $6 |
| 平衡型(示例B) |
2 vCPU / 4GB / 80GB SSD |
3 TB |
~45 ms |
约 $18 |
- 表格数据为示例测得值,用于比较成本与性能的权衡。
- 对于静态内容高的业务,优先用轻量型+CDN可压缩成本。
4.
缓存与 CDN 策略减少带宽与延迟
- 将静态资源(图片、JS、CSS)完全交给 CDN 节点缓存,降低源站带宽。
- 设置合理的 Cache-Control 和 ETag,提升命中率,示例:静态命中率提升到 85% 时源站带宽下降 ~70%。
- 对动态接口采用边缘缓存(短 TTL)或缓存预热,减少后端压力。
- 使用对象存储作为静态源站,减少磁盘 I/O 与快照成本。
- 对于支付/登录等敏感路径禁用缓存并用长连接与连接池优化后端并发。
5.
安全与 DDoS 防护的成本控制
- 启用提供商基础防护(流量清洗+黑洞路由),避免被攻击时额外带宽账单暴涨。
- 设置速率限制与 WAF 规则,阻挡常见爬虫与恶意请求,示例阈值:同一 IP 30 秒内超过 100 请求进入二次验证。
- 对成本敏感企业优先选用按需清洗,而非长期高成本托管,平时监控告警及时开启防护。
- 结合 CDN 的边缘封堵可将大部分攻击流量在边缘消耗,减少源站流量费用。
- 定期演练故障切换与流量抑制策略,保障在攻击时最低可接受成本内恢复服务。
6.
真实案例:小型电商在 ConoHa 新加坡 CN2 的优化历程
- 初始配置:1 vCPU / 1GB / 40GB,直接对外,月带宽超支且页面加载 4.2s。
- 优化措施:迁移到 Singapore(CN2)、启用 BBR、增加 CDN、缓存规则与简单 WAF。
- 优化后配置:2 vCPU / 2GB / 60GB + CDN,平均页面加载降至 1.6s,P95 响应从 800ms 降至 230ms。
- 成本变化:实例成本从约 $6 增到 $12,CDN 与带宽合计约 $5,整体月成本增加约 $11,但因用户体验提升转化率提升 18%,ROI 正向。
- 启示:在 ConoHa 新加坡 CN2 环境下,合理配置与边缘优化能在可控成本内显著提升性能与商业回报。
来源:成本敏感型企业在conoha 新加坡 cn2上实现性能平衡的技巧